Job description

Who are we looking for

This position is responsible for the delivery of payroll services including operations support and projects support to APAC countries in accordance with Company Service Level Agreements that will ensure accuracy and timeliness as well as full compliance with legislation, company policy and control procedures. The position requires the ability to work on various APAC HR and payroll related projects and continuously look to improve the efficiency of day-to-day payroll operations through work process improvements.

What you will be responsible for
  • Managing & administration of the company Payroll shared services and ensuring compliance and accuracy in monthly Payroll activities
  • Ensuring timely and accurate delivery of payroll
  • Overall responsibility for payroll processing and administration
  • Must have minimum of 5 to 6 years of APAC- Philippines, Hong Kong, Singapore, Malaysia and Australia payroll processing experience
  • Manage certain time bound processes and ensure validation of data to be accurate and truthful
  • Ensuring timelines are met for salary disbursement and statutory compliance
  • Ensuring Employee Benefits including Employee reimbursements as per rules and regulations of income tax
  • Responsible for value adds and Payroll process Standardization
  • Verification & Reconciliation of monthly payroll
  • Preparation & Submission of monthly, annual statutory contributions
  • Steer the year-end processing where applicable and ensure timely activities are met
  • Responsible of publishing monthly Payroll Dashboard
  • Ensure Monthly payroll provisions to Finance
  • Maintaining payroll operations by following policies and procedures
  • Resolving payroll discrepancies and be proactive enough to elevate discrepancies within the Governance timeframes
  • Demonstrate high professionalism and flexibility towards work assigned
What are we looking for
  • 5+ years of payroll operation and administration experience
  • Preferably Philippines, Hongkong, Singapore, Malaysia and Australia of APAC region
  • Working knowledge of statutory legislation and procedure relating to payroll
  • Experience in working various HR and Payroll projects
  • Working knowledge of a Payroll/HR system
  • Excellent working knowledge of Microsoft Excel
  • Evidence of a confident communication style and clear written communication
  • Resilience and the ability to work independently in a fast paced environment
  • Deliver results with a strong focus on accuracy and attention to detail
